Wossner is Germany's finest aftermarket forged piston and rod manufacturer and have over 25 years of experience in the high-performance racing industry. Top European racers and FIM World Champions rely on Wossner for only the best pistons, rods and customer service.

Features

  • In-house designed and manufactured; all forgings are produced in Wossner's company-owned forging operation
  • 4-stroke pistons are made using a double-bridged forging design
  • Lightweight pistons with the tightest piston-wall clearances in the industry give you a quieter running engine
  • All pistons include piston, ring, wrist pin and pin locks
  • Wossner pistons are used by leading Supercross, Arenacross and MX GP teams
  • Made in Germany

Specifications

  • Piston Size: 76.96mm
  • Oversize: Standard
  • Wossner Compression: 14.00:1
  • OEM Compression: 13.50:1
  • Number of Rings: 2
  • Replacement Rings: RIK77.00D
  • Replacement Wrist Pin: WP070
  • Replacement Circlip: CW16

NOTE: Wossner Piston Kits include the Piston, Wrist Pin, Circlips & Rings, Needle Bearings are not included.
